Lake Cowal, in Central West NSW, is the "heartland of the
Wiradjuri Nation". Wiradjuri Traditional Owners are carrying the Sacred
Fire to Lake Cowal where Canada's Barrick Gold has plans for a cyanide
leach gold mine.
Lake Cowal is of national and international importance, a precious wetland
registered on the Australia's National Estate.172 bird species inhabit
the lake, including internationally protected migratory waders from China
and Japan. Canadian company Barrick Gold has applied for a CONSENT TO
DESTROY Aboriginal objects at the site. Arsenic and cyanide severely threaten
the wetland, Lachlan River and surrounds.
